Whenever I click to add a folder or an app to pin to start10, the pinning is working, but for some reason the pinned items are saved to c:\temp\new folder\User Pinned\StartMenu instead of %AppData%\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\Quick Launch\User Pinned\StartMenu. How can I reset the default user pinned folder to %AppData%\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\Quick Launch\User Pinned\

I followed your instructions and installed 1.15 RC, but the issue was still present. I did some more testing and made an important observation. If windows explorer is in a maximized window state then a tab is prevented from being dragged out of the group. You can only drag a tab out of the group if window is not maximized.
